Many states have a statute of limitation or time limit within which individuals have to take legal action to receive compensation for mesothelioma. The time frame varies by state, but the majority of mesothelioma lawsuits have to be filed within one to three years of diagnosis.

They charge Contingency Fees

Most mesothelioma compensation lawyers operate on a contingency fee basis. This means that they only get paid if they receive compensation for their client. This is ideal for mesothelioma patients since they don't have to pay upfront to hire a lawyer.

It is advisable to inquire about the cost of the attorney before hiring them. Many attorneys may charge on an hourly basis which can be a significant amount quickly when a case goes to trial. Some firms also advertise that they have years of expertise in handling mesothelioma cases however they don't actually handle cases themselves. They refer the case to another firm in exchange for a part of the attorney's fees.

On average, mesothelioma patients receive between $1 million and $1.4 million in compensation. A jury verdict could result in more substantial awards.

Mesothelioma lawsuits can also assist veterans to obtain compensation through the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). Patients with mesothelioma may be eligible for financial assistance, which includes monthly payments, as well as free or low-cost medical treatment. Attorneys can assist veterans to determine which trust funds they should file claims with and can also file VA claim paperwork on their behalf. Mesothelioma veterans should choose an attorney firm that has an extensive military practice and understands VA benefits in and out.
